The Star-Bulletin's countdown of UH football's "Centurions", the 100 greatest players in the University of Hawaii's 100 years of football, continues with #13, receiver Ashley Lelie.Joe Edwards profiles Lelie.No Hawaii fan will ever forget Lelie's spectacular, leaping, last-second touchdown grab that gave the Warriors a 38-34 victory over Fresno State. That single catch rocked Aloha Stadium. It was, perhaps, the biggest single catch in Warrior history. On national TV. Against the No. 18 team in the land. Capping a nine-catch, 122-yard effort that only got in gear after a crushing hit by Fresno State safety Cameron Worrell."That hit woke me up," Lelie said.Indeed.A couple of series later, Lelie first caught a 45-yard pass to put the Warriors in scoring position.
